/* Based on public domain code hacked by Colin Plumb, Andrew Kuchling, and
* Niels Mller. */
#include "md5.h"
#include "macros.h"
#include <assert.h>
#include <string.h>
/* A block, treated as a sequence of 32-bit words. */
#define MD5_DATA_LENGTH 16
static void
md5_transform(uint32_t *digest, const uint32_t *data);
static void
md5_block(struct md5_ctx *ctx, const uint8_t *block);
void
md5_init(struct md5_ctx *ctx)
{
ctx->digest[0] = 0x67452301;
ctx->digest[1] = 0xefcdab89;
ctx->digest[2] = 0x98badcfe;
ctx->digest[3] = 0x10325476;
ctx->count_l = ctx->count_h = 0;
ctx->index = 0;
}
void
md5_update(struct md5_ctx *ctx,
unsigned length,
const uint8_t *data)
{
if (ctx->index)
{
/* Try to fill partial block */
unsigned left = MD5_DATA_SIZE - ctx->index;
if (length < left)
{
memcpy(ctx->block + ctx->index, data, length);
ctx->index += length;
return; /* Finished */
